Produktbeschreibung
A successful man confronts his hustler youth when an old friend is murdered in this crime novel exploring the gritty gay Village of '80s Manchester.

At thirty-four years old, Jake Powell is a consummate professional in charge of an upscale casino in the West End of London. But fifteen years ago, Jake was hustling on the fringes of Manchester's gay Village: running wild with a crowd of rentboys, purse-snatchers and disco trash; sleeping with anyone and everything.

In those days, Jake did a lot of things he's not proud of. And what little he does remember he'd prefer to forget. But when Detective Inspector Davey Green takes a sudden and unexpected interest in his past, Jake is forced to confront the dirty secrets that led to the murder of his best friend...
Autorenporträt
Nicholas Blincoe is an author, critic and screenwriter. His many novels include the highly-acclaimed Manchester Slingback, which won the CWA Silver Dagger award in 1998. Born in Rochdale, he attended the University of Warwick, where he completed a PhD in contemporary European philosophy.
